how much do the Skins have to spend?

As of right now, around $15.9 million give or take 1/2 million. But that number will be subject to guys currently on roster who will likely be let go, as well as resignings. So safe bet is $10 million, this accounts for the rookie pool.

As for cap space I kind of hate it when we say Team X has 20 mil in cap space but Team Y has only 12. Well Team Y may have 45 guys already signed and Team X may still need to fill out their roster. So cap space alone doesn't mean that much
